Enforce cacheLimit in DefaultSubscriptionRegistry

When the cacheLimit is reached and there is an eviction from the
updateCache, the accessCache is now also updated.

This change also ensures that adding a destination to the cache is
protected with synchronization on the updateCache.

Issue: SPR-13555
